Default Electrical help

Guys I went on a weekend trip three weeks ago. Rode in two days of rain. I noticed my gear indicator is now gone from my gage and the cruise won’t work. Any help would be greatly appreciated. It did flicker a couple times during the trip then went out. This is on a 2014 Street Glide Special.

There's another thread about this very thing, I just posted to it a couple days ago... you may want to search for it.. you are NOT alone in this..

My incident happened on a 2012 Limited, that I drove through a very heavy rain storm for about two hours. My cruise control quit working for the rest of the day. It then started working again, on its own...

I brought it up during my initial service about a week later (it was a new bike), and the tech claimed he had never heard of that happening before. Since it was now working, there was nothing for him to really check for..

It never happened again, even though I got caught in several other rain storms during my ownership of that bike... I just chalked it up to something got wet, then dried out...

Since it has been awhile since you were in the rain, it's possible in your case, something got wet and shorted out a switch.... Pull codes, it should give you a place to start...
